ºÝºÝߣ
Submit Search
Dr. George Gitau Njoroge
8
Followers
47
Followings
Follow
Block User
8
Followers
47
Followings
Personal Information
Organization / Workplace
Kenya Kenya
Occupation
University Librarian at Kenyatta University
Industry
Education
Contact Details